MICROCHIP ATMEGA32U4-AU
| Manufacturer | |
| MPN | ATMEGA32U4-AU |
| LCSC Part # | C44854 |
| Packaging | QFP-44(10x10) |
| Customer # | |
| Key Attributes | High Performance, Low Power AVR 8-Bit Microcontroller with USB 2.0 Device Module |
| Datasheet |
Products Specifications
Show similar products (0) >| Type | Description | |
|---|---|---|
| Category | Integrated Circuits (ICs)/Embedded/Microcontrollers | |
| Manufacturer | MICROCHIP | |
| Packaging | QFP-44(10x10) | |
| ADC (Bit) | 10bit | |
| Operating Temperature | -40℃~+85℃ | |
| Voltage - Supply | 2.7V~5.5V | |
| Program Memory Type | FLASH | |
| EEPROM | 1KB | |
| Program Storage Size | 32KB | |
| CPU Core | AVR | |
| Core Size | 8 Bit | |
| CPU Maximum Speed | 16MHz | |
| Oscillator Type | Built-in | |
| Number of I/O | 26 |
Report an ErrorShow similar products (0) >
Additional Information
| Type | Details |
|---|---|
| Minimum | 1 |
| Multiple | 1 |
| Standard Packaging | 160 |
| Sales Unit | Piece |
| EDA Models | EasyEDA Model |
Introduction
AI Translation
The ATmega16U4/ATmega32U4 is a low-power CMOS 8-bit microcontroller based on the AVR enhanced RISC architecture. By executing powerful instructions in a single clock cycle, the ATmega16U4/ATmega32U4 achieves throughputs approaching 1 MIPS per MHz allowing the system designer to optimize power consumption versus processing speed.
Features
AI Translation
- High Performance, Low Power AVR 8-Bit Microcontroller
- Advanced RISC Architecture – 135 Powerful Instructions – Most Single Clock Cycle Execution – 32x8 General Purpose Working Registers – Fully Static Operation – Up to 16 MIPS Throughput at 16 MHz – On-Chip 2-cycle Multiplier
- Non-volatile Program and Data Memories – 16/32K Bytes of In-System Self-Programmable Flash (ATmega16U4/ATmega32U4) – 1.25/2.5K Bytes Internal SRAM (ATmega16U4/ATmega32U4) – 512Bytes/1K Bytes Internal EEPROM (ATmega16U4/ATmega32U4) – Write/Erase Cycles: 10,000 Flash/100,000 EEPROM – Data retention: 20 years at 85℃, 100 years at 25℃ – Optional Boot Code Section with Independent Lock Bits In-System Programming by On-chip Boot Program True Read-While-Write Operation All supplied parts are preprogramed with a default USB bootloader – Programming Lock for Software Security
- JTAG (IEEE std. 1149.1 compliant) Interface – Boundary-scan Capabilities According to the JTAG Standard – Extensive On-chip Debug Support – Programming of Flash, EEPROM, Fuses, and Lock Bits through the JTAG Interface
- USB 2.0 Full-speed/Low Speed Device Module with Interrupt on Transfer Completion – Complies fully with Universal Serial Bus Specification Rev 2.0 – Supports data transfer rates up to 12 Mbit/s and 1.5 Mbit/s – Endpoint 0 for Control Transfers: up to 64-bytes – 6 Programmable Endpoints with IN or Out Directions and with Bulk, Interrupt or Isochronous Transfers – Configurable Endpoints size up to 256 bytes in double bank mode – Fully independent 832 bytes USB DPRAM for endpoint memory allocation – Suspend/Resume Interrupts – CPU Reset possible on USB Bus Reset detection – 48 MHz from PLL for Full-speed Bus Operation – USB Bus Connection/Disconnection on Microcontroller Request – Crystal-less operation for Low Speed mode
- Peripheral Features – On-chip PLL for USB and High Speed Timer: 32 up to 96 MHz operation – One 8-bit Timer/Counter with Separate Prescaler and Compare Mode – Two 16-bit Timer/Counter with Separate Prescaler, Compare- and Capture Mode – One 10-bit High-Speed Timer/Counter with PLL (64 MHz) and Compare Mode – Four 8-bit PWM Channels – Four PWM Channels with Programmable Resolution from 2 to 16 Bits – Six PWM Channels for High Speed Operation, with Programmable Resolution from 2 to 11 Bits – Output Compare Modulator – 12-channels, 10-bit ADC (features Differential Channels with Programmable Gain) – Programmable Serial USART with Hardware Flow Control – Master/Slave SPI Serial Interface – Byte Oriented 2-wire Serial Interface – Programmable Watchdog Timer with Separate On-chip Oscillator – On-chip Analog Comparator – Interrupt and Wake-up on Pin Change – On-chip Temperature Sensor
- Special Microcontroller Features – Power-on Reset and Programmable Brown-out Detection – Internal 8 MHz Calibrated Oscillator – Internal clock prescaler & On-the-fly Clock Switching (Int RC / Ext Osc) – External and Internal Interrupt Sources – Six Sleep Modes: Idle, ADC Noise Reduction, Power-save, Power-down, Standby, and Extended Standby
- I/O and Packages – All I/O combine CMOS outputs and LVTTL inputs – 26 Programmable I/O Lines
- Operating Voltages – 2.7 - 5.5V Operating temperature – Industrial (-40℃ to +85℃)
- Maximum Frequency – 8 MHz at 2.7V - Industrial range – 16 MHz at 4.5V - Industrial range
In-Stock: 1,975
1,975 In stock, ships now
Add to BOM List
| Qty | Unit Price | Total Amount |
|---|---|---|
| 1+ | $ 7.8057$ 6.4788 | $ 6.48 |
| 10+ | $ 6.8998$ 5.7269 | $ 57.27 |
| 30+ | $ 5.7254$ 4.7521 | $ 142.56 |
| 100+ | $ 5.2635$ 4.3688 | $ 436.88 |
Standard Packaging160/Full Tray | ||
Better price for more quantity?
$
Products Specifications
Show similar products (0) >| Type | Description | |
|---|---|---|
| Category | Integrated Circuits (ICs)/Embedded/Microcontrollers | |
| Manufacturer | MICROCHIP | |
| Packaging | QFP-44(10x10) | |
| ADC (Bit) | 10bit | |
| Operating Temperature | -40℃~+85℃ | |
| Voltage - Supply | 2.7V~5.5V | |
| Program Memory Type | FLASH | |
| EEPROM | 1KB | |
| Program Storage Size | 32KB | |
| CPU Core | AVR | |
| Core Size | 8 Bit | |
| CPU Maximum Speed | 16MHz | |
| Oscillator Type | Built-in | |
| Number of I/O | 26 |
Report an ErrorShow similar products (0) >
Additional Information
| Type | Details |
|---|---|
| Minimum | 1 |
| Multiple | 1 |
| Standard Packaging | 160 |
| Sales Unit | Piece |
| EDA Models | EasyEDA Model |
Introduction
AI Translation
The ATmega16U4/ATmega32U4 is a low-power CMOS 8-bit microcontroller based on the AVR enhanced RISC architecture. By executing powerful instructions in a single clock cycle, the ATmega16U4/ATmega32U4 achieves throughputs approaching 1 MIPS per MHz allowing the system designer to optimize power consumption versus processing speed.
Features
AI Translation
- High Performance, Low Power AVR 8-Bit Microcontroller
- Advanced RISC Architecture – 135 Powerful Instructions – Most Single Clock Cycle Execution – 32x8 General Purpose Working Registers – Fully Static Operation – Up to 16 MIPS Throughput at 16 MHz – On-Chip 2-cycle Multiplier
- Non-volatile Program and Data Memories – 16/32K Bytes of In-System Self-Programmable Flash (ATmega16U4/ATmega32U4) – 1.25/2.5K Bytes Internal SRAM (ATmega16U4/ATmega32U4) – 512Bytes/1K Bytes Internal EEPROM (ATmega16U4/ATmega32U4) – Write/Erase Cycles: 10,000 Flash/100,000 EEPROM – Data retention: 20 years at 85℃, 100 years at 25℃ – Optional Boot Code Section with Independent Lock Bits In-System Programming by On-chip Boot Program True Read-While-Write Operation All supplied parts are preprogramed with a default USB bootloader – Programming Lock for Software Security
- JTAG (IEEE std. 1149.1 compliant) Interface – Boundary-scan Capabilities According to the JTAG Standard – Extensive On-chip Debug Support – Programming of Flash, EEPROM, Fuses, and Lock Bits through the JTAG Interface
- USB 2.0 Full-speed/Low Speed Device Module with Interrupt on Transfer Completion – Complies fully with Universal Serial Bus Specification Rev 2.0 – Supports data transfer rates up to 12 Mbit/s and 1.5 Mbit/s – Endpoint 0 for Control Transfers: up to 64-bytes – 6 Programmable Endpoints with IN or Out Directions and with Bulk, Interrupt or Isochronous Transfers – Configurable Endpoints size up to 256 bytes in double bank mode – Fully independent 832 bytes USB DPRAM for endpoint memory allocation – Suspend/Resume Interrupts – CPU Reset possible on USB Bus Reset detection – 48 MHz from PLL for Full-speed Bus Operation – USB Bus Connection/Disconnection on Microcontroller Request – Crystal-less operation for Low Speed mode
- Peripheral Features – On-chip PLL for USB and High Speed Timer: 32 up to 96 MHz operation – One 8-bit Timer/Counter with Separate Prescaler and Compare Mode – Two 16-bit Timer/Counter with Separate Prescaler, Compare- and Capture Mode – One 10-bit High-Speed Timer/Counter with PLL (64 MHz) and Compare Mode – Four 8-bit PWM Channels – Four PWM Channels with Programmable Resolution from 2 to 16 Bits – Six PWM Channels for High Speed Operation, with Programmable Resolution from 2 to 11 Bits – Output Compare Modulator – 12-channels, 10-bit ADC (features Differential Channels with Programmable Gain) – Programmable Serial USART with Hardware Flow Control – Master/Slave SPI Serial Interface – Byte Oriented 2-wire Serial Interface – Programmable Watchdog Timer with Separate On-chip Oscillator – On-chip Analog Comparator – Interrupt and Wake-up on Pin Change – On-chip Temperature Sensor
- Special Microcontroller Features – Power-on Reset and Programmable Brown-out Detection – Internal 8 MHz Calibrated Oscillator – Internal clock prescaler & On-the-fly Clock Switching (Int RC / Ext Osc) – External and Internal Interrupt Sources – Six Sleep Modes: Idle, ADC Noise Reduction, Power-save, Power-down, Standby, and Extended Standby
- I/O and Packages – All I/O combine CMOS outputs and LVTTL inputs – 26 Programmable I/O Lines
- Operating Voltages – 2.7 - 5.5V Operating temperature – Industrial (-40℃ to +85℃)
- Maximum Frequency – 8 MHz at 2.7V - Industrial range – 16 MHz at 4.5V - Industrial range
Compliance & Export Codes
| Type | Details |
|---|---|
| RoHS | |
| ECCN | EAR99 |
| CNHTS | 8542319090 |
| USHTS | |
| TARIC | |
| CAHTS | |
| BRHTS | |
| INHTS | |
| MXHTS |
| Type | Details |
|---|---|
| RoHS | |
| ECCN | EAR99 |
| CNHTS | 8542319090 |
| USHTS | |
| TARIC |
| Type | Details |
|---|---|
| CAHTS | |
| BRHTS | |
| INHTS | |
| MXHTS | |



